Turkish Airlines is running additional flights on its Abu Dhabi-Istanbul route until July 19, the airline announced.
Abu Dhabi based Etihad Airlines is rapidly expanding to many international markets, and has a very prominent position in the United Arab Emirates.
With Turkish Airlines increasing flights, this will open up new interconnection into the rest of the Star Alliance network.
Turkish Airlines had been voted as one of the best airlines in service within the alliance, so this development is interesting.
There will be three extra flights each week operating with a 151 passenger capacity on board a Boeing 737-800. The additional services are running on Tuesday, Thursday and Saturday.
The increase in frequency out of Abu Dhabi comes at the beginning of the traditionally busy summer northern hemisphere travel period.
